This plot

This is MUSE TRACE_vignet health check plot. It monitors vignetting of the Calibration Unit mask by assessing difference in width of the slices: top left (slice10) and bottom left (slice 3), (red dots), as well as top right (slice 46) and bottom right (slice 39), (green dots). Only data points extracted from LAMP_FLAT calibrations taken in the instrumental mode (INS.MODE) WFM-NOAO-E and the read out mode (DET.READ.CURNAME) SCI1.0 are selected.

The LAMP_FLAT calibration data are taken with template TPL.ID=MUSE_wfm_cal_specflat
